Gresso To Launch An iPad Made From A 200 Years Old Wood And 18k Gold

If you have more money than you need and want to buy a luxury tablet device, then check the new one from Gresso, a luxury Apple iPad or with another name, the iPad Gresso.

It is framed in a 200 years old African Blackwood, which is said to be the most valuable tree in the world, while the Apple logo is made of pure 18k gold.
